DTPA-tetra (t-Bu ester) (Cat No.: M134107) is a protected derivative of diethylenetriaminepentaacetic acid (DTPA), where four carboxyl groups are esterified with tert-butyl groups. This esterified form enhances solubility in organic solvents and improves stability, making it useful in chelation chemistry and metal complexation studies. It serves as an intermediate in the synthesis of metal chelators for medical imaging, radiopharmaceuticals, and contrast agents. Upon hydrolysis, it regenerates the free DTPA ligand, which has applications in metal ion sequestration and detoxification therapies.
